WebWell defined opacities in lung on X-ray can be due to a benign or malignant nodule, tuberculosis, pneumonia or any infarct or granulomatosis. The opacities can also be diffuse—as seen in as in fluid collection, fibrosis, asbestosis, silicosis, tuberculosis etc. You will need more specialized tests like CT chest for a confirmed diagnosis. WebAtelectasis happens when lung sacs (alveoli) can’t inflate properly, which means blood, tissues and organs may not get oxygen. It can be caused by pressure outside of your lung, a blockage, low airflow or scarring. The most common cause of atelectasis is surgery with anesthesia. Diagnosis: Lung Opacity is not a diagnosis or specific finding. It is a vague appearance seen on a chest X-ray or CT. The cause of the finding needs to be determined before a treatment is formulated. Causes can range from scarring from prior infections, trauma, fluid, infection, allergy, drowning, smoke ...

Lung abnormalities with an increased density - also called opacities - are the most common. A practical approach is to divide these into four patterns: Consolidation. Interstitial. Hazy opacities can also be referred to as ground glass opacities. Ground glass is when glass is made to be white or frosted.
